Method

Chicken Fingers

  1. 1

    Prepare the Chicken

    Cut chicken breast fillets into finger-sized pieces.

  2. 2

    Set Up Your Breading Station

    In three separate bowls, place flour in one, beaten eggs in another, and breadcrumbs mixed with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and paprika in the third bowl.

  3. 3

    Bread the Chicken

    Dip each chicken piece first into flour, then into the egg, and finally into the breadcrumb mixture, ensuring each piece is well coated.

  4. 4

    Fry the Chicken

    Heat oil in a deep frying pan over medium heat. Once hot, carefully place the breaded chicken pieces into the oil. Fry until golden brown and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es. Remove and place on paper towels to drain excess oil.

French Fries

  1. 5

    Prepare the Potatoes

    Peel the potatoes and cut them into thick strips for fries.

  2. 6

    Soak the Potatoes

    Soak the cut potatoes in water for at least 30 minutes to remove excess starch, which helps achieve crispiness.

  3. 7

    Fry the Potatoes

    Heat oil in a deep fryer or large pot. Once hot, drain the potatoes and add them to the oil in batches. Fry until golden brown and crispy, about 5-7 minutes per batch. Remove and drain on paper towels, then season with salt.

Coleslaw

  1. 8

    Prepare the Vegetables

    Finely shred the green cabbage and grate the carrot.

  2. 9

    Make the Dressing

    In a large bowl, whisk together mayonnaise, apple cider vinegar, sugar, salt, and black pepper until well combined.

  3. 10

    Combine and Toss

    Add the shredded cabbage and carrot to the dressing and toss until well coated.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ow flavors to meld.
